Melissa Callender
Melissa Callender is a certified yoga instructor, postpartum doula, writer and artist based in Brooklyn, New York.
Her work centers on supporting people through periods of transition with care, presence, and respect, particularly during pregnancy, the postpartum period, and other tender life thresholds. She specializes in vinyasa, prenatal, postnatal, and trauma-informed yoga, and offers postpartum doula support rooted in nourishment, nervous-system care, and emotional attunement.
Melissa’s approach is both practical and intuitive. She supports her students as whole humans, encouraging people to explore all parts of themselves, and not shy away from the unknown or difficult.
In her doula work, she supports the birthing person as a whole human. Tending to rest, recovery, and daily rhythms, while offering steady, non-judgmental support for families as they settle into life with a newborn. Her background in somatics and yoga informs the way she works with the body, emphasizing consent, accessibility, and deep listening.
Melissa teaches Community, Flow and Unwind, Meditation, Flow and Journal at Arise Bed Stuy and Crown Heights.
